1. What Mailinizer does
Mailinizer connects to mailboxes you own or are authorised to use, and applies automated and AI-assisted processing — sorting, categorising, summarising, and drafting replies — to help you get through them. It is an assistant, not a replacement for your own judgement.

3. Plans, billing and cancellation
Mailinizer offers a free tier and paid subscriptions. Paid plans purchased in the mobile apps are billed by Apple (App Store) or Google (Google Play) under their terms — we never see your card details. We use RevenueCat to record entitlements and keep your plan in sync across devices.
- Subscriptions renew automatically for the same period until cancelled.
- Cancel through the store you bought from — Apple or Google — not through us; we cannot cancel a store subscription on your behalf. Cancelling stops the next renewal and you keep access until the paid period ends.
- Refunds are handled by the store under its own policy. Where Austrian or EU consumer law gives you a stronger right, that law wins.
- AI features consume credits from your plan's allowance. We will tell you in-app before a change to allowances takes effect.

5. Third-party mailboxes and Google user data
When you connect an account, you authorise us to access it on your behalf using the permissions you grant. You can revoke that access at any time — in Mailinizer, or from your provider's own security settings.
Mailinizer's use and transfer of information received from Google APIs to any other app will adhere to the Google API Services User Data Policy, including the Limited Use requirements. We do not use Gmail data for advertising, we do not sell it, and we do not use it to train generalised AI models.
6. AI output — read before you send
Categories, summaries, and drafts are generated by statistical models and can be wrong, incomplete, or misleading. Nothing is sent from your mailbox without your action. You are responsible for reviewing anything Mailinizer drafts before it goes out, and Mailinizer's output is not legal, financial, medical, or tax advice.
